Output 11e8086c1ddab299fe862cd34ed8b4ba17ca699bec57ebe1cce5ff3adc83866d:0

value
70316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1035e1733075398d8324e64968a80cd472e403f OP_EQUAL
address
3PfNoknfRxdNaUWLZBKxzwr43EbMWqvzcX
transaction
11e8086c1ddab299fe862cd34ed8b4ba17ca699bec57ebe1cce5ff3adc83866d
confirmations
99141
spent
true